Less time to claim high PI incentive in BVD scheme

Agriculture Minister Michael Creed has announced increased financial support in 2017 for early removal of PI (persistently infected) calves, including dairy crosses and dairy bulls for the first time.

Farmers will get €150 if female dairy and dairy cross PI calves are removed within 21 days of the first positive or inconclusive test; or €35 if removed between day 22 and 35.
